| 6/23/25 | ![]() 🎬 Star Wars Road Trip: Inside Rancho Obi-Wan | 🚀 Kurt Ho and Eric V. join the Ricks for a closer look at the brand called “Star Wars”—including the marketing deliverables, games, toys, and more on display at Rancho Obi-Wan, the largest private collection of Star Wars memorabilia in the world. Learn why the story that started “a long time ago, in a galaxy far, far away…” continues to take fans into the future.
